Overview
Our client is embarking on a strategic transformation aimed at enhancing its data integration capabilities. This initiative focuses on analyzing and documenting the existing integration layer, which operates on Informatica PowerCenter and Oracle, to define requirements for a future architecture.
Key Responsibilities
- Analyze current data integration logic.
- Document embedded business logic within ETL and SQL views.
- Define implementation-ready requirements for the new architecture.
- Collaborate with architects, project managers, and downstream teams.
Experience Requirements
A strong background in the banking domain is essential, with 5 to 9 years of relevant experience. Responsibilities include:
- Assessing data consumption patterns of assigned applications.
- Identifying and documenting business logic from PowerCenter and Oracle views.
- Translating findings into structured technical requirements.

Analysis and Specification Responsibilities
The integration layer must be thoroughly analyzed to define requirements for applications impacted by re-wiring. Responsibilities include:
- Understanding data flows within the integration layer and collaborating with affected applications to specify necessary changes.
- Specifying functionality for applications where business logic resides within the integration layer.
- Implementing re-wiring of new source systems in exception cases.

Scope of Work
This role is dedicated to analysis and documentation, with no involvement in implementation or coding tasks. It is not suited for data scientists, database administrators, or solution architects, and does not require product-specific banking expertise beyond general knowledge.
